War talk in Aurora urges total national effort in blood toil

Congressmen Sloan tells Aurora at a Y M C A meeting that public support for war has surged from opposition to broad unity. He stresses the trench test of character and asks if citizens have backed the nation financially and with service, noting Belgium and northern France suffer Teutonic brutality.

Rosenberry and Willis Wed in Wayland Parsonage

Mr. J. J. Rosenberry and Mrs. Jessie Willis were married last Thursday in the Wayland parsonage by Rev. C. B. Nelson after presenting a license. Rosenberry, a local farmer, had bached five years while Mrs. Willis, from Trenton Missouri, recently moved here and made friends. The couple express hopes for a happier life together.

Oats Investigations

Nebraska Experiment Station issues a bulletin on oats testing over 15 years showing early varieties suit most Nebraska and yield more than late types. In 12 years three early varieties averaged 11.1 bushels per acre 22 percent higher than four later varieties. Nebraska No 21 white Kherson strain yielded 9 to 15 percent more than the Kherson source.

MURDER PLEA AND FLIGHT IN UNWRITTEN LAW CASE

Chobar admits jealousy and says he acted under the unwritten law when killing his employer Blender in York county Nebraska. He tied his wife and fled with small funds, later surrendering in Todd county after months on the run. Authorities weigh whether the wife will corroborate or deny the tale as the trial date nears.

Four pounds flour per week deemed reasonable supply

Gordon W. Wattles, Federal Food Administrator for Nebraska, defines four pounds of flour per week per person as a reasonable amount to ensure even nationwide distribution. He calls for voluntary citizen cooperation to stabilize prices and prevent shortages while keeping bread affordable for all.
